Step One: Understanding the Basics

The Art of Mobile Photography: Capturing the Detail and Quality of Hardware Accessories

Before diving into the technical aspects of mobile photography, it is essential to have a basic understanding of what constitutes a good photo. A good photo should have clear composition, good lighting, and focus that enhances the subject. In the case of hardware accessories, these elements are particularly important as they require attention to detail to accurately convey their functionality and quality.

Step Two: Using the Right Equipment

To take high-quality photos of hardware accessories, one needs to invest in the right equipment. A camera with a high megapixel count and good optical zoom capability is ideal, especially for close-up shots or detailed images of small parts. A tripod helps to stabilize the camera while shooting, preventing blurry results caused by shaky hands. A remote shutter release or timer ensures that exposure remains consistent even when handholding the camera.

Step Three: Composition

Composition is key to creating a visually appealing image of hardware accessories. The rule of thirds is a useful guideline to follow when arranging objects in a photo. Focus on the main subject and avoid clutter. Keep the background simple and uncluttered, ensuring that your viewer's attention remains on the accessory you want to highlight. Additionally, use natural light sources where possible, as artificial lights can distort the colors and texture of the object.

Step Four: Capturing Details

Hardware accessories often come with unique features that make them stand out. To capture these details effectively, consider using different angles and focal points. For instance, instead of taking a front shot, try a side angle or a profile shot to reveal hidden details like screw heads or bolt patterns. Close-ups can also help to emphasize specific features like the finish of a metal surface or the precision of a machined part.

The Art of Mobile Photography: Capturing the Detail and Quality of Hardware Accessories

Step Five: Lighting Techniques

The lighting plays a crucial role in capturing a hardware accessory's true beauty. Soft, diffused light is preferred for highlighting textures and shadows without casting harsh shadows. Natural light is best suited for outdoor shoots, but indoors, consider using a reflector or flash to fill in shadows and create more contrast. Be mindful of the direction of light as it can affect the appearance of the accessory.

Step Six: Editing and Presentation

Once you have taken the photos, editing them to perfection is essential. Use software like Adobe Photoshop or Lightroom to adjust brightness and contrast, fix any issues like red-eye, and crop the image if necessary. Add filters or effects to enhance the color scheme and make the photo pop. Finally, ensure that all the images are properly organized and labeled to facilitate easy viewing and reference.
